This ratio was then multiplied by the LD50 of the pesticide for <br /> which the soil criteria was calculated. <br /> Subsurface Soil and Groundwater Samples <br /> 1 <br /> TPH and Purgeable Aromatics- Petroleum hydrocarbons and purgeable aromatics <br /> (BXTE) were detected only in soils from borings B-1 and MW-1 and groundwater <br /> F from monitoring well MW-1 . Boring B-1 and monitoring well MW-1 are located <br /> near the underground storage tank. Both gasoline and diesel hydrocarbons were <br /> detected in the groundwater samples from MW-1. In addition, constituents of <br /> gasoline (BXTE) were detected in water samples from this well TPH and BXTE <br /> were not detected in groundwater or soil samples collected from the other <br /> monitoring wells (MW-2, MW-3, MW-4) during this investigation. Benzene in <br /> water from MW-1 was the only constituent which exceeded drinking water <br /> standards. <br /> A soil sample collected from the 20.0- to 20.5-foot depth interval in boring <br /> B-1 contained TPH as diesel (68 mg/Kg), benzene (44 ug/Kg) , toluene (32 <br /> ug/Kg) , ethylbenzene (64 ug/Kg) , and xylenes at (312 ug/Kg) . A soil sample <br /> collected from the 15 5- to 16.0-foot interval in borings MW-1 contained TPH <br /> as diesel (10 mg/Kg) , benzene (4 ug/Kg) , and toluene (3 ug/Kg) . Xylenes and <br /> other purgeable aromatics were not detected above method detection limits in <br /> this sample. <br /> With the exception of toluene, purgeable aromatics were not detected in soil <br /> samples from B-2, MW-2, MW-3, and MW-4. Toluene was detected in soil samples <br /> from all of the borings at concentrations ranging from 4 ug/Kg to 32 ug/Kg <br /> However, these concentrations could be attributed to laboratory artifacts. <br /> Chlorinated benzenes were not detected in any water or soil samples analyzed. <br /> Nitrate: Low concentrations of nitrate were detected in soil and groundwater <br /> samples collected from the soil borings and monitoring wells. However, only <br /> one water sample (from MW-2) contained nitrate at concentrations exceeding EPA <br /> drinking water standards. Nitrate concentrations in groundwater samples <br /> collected at the site ranged from 0.09 mg/L as nitrogen (N) in the <br /> reconnaissance groundwater sample collected from boring B-2 to 29 mg/L as <br /> nitrogen in the groundwater sample collected from well MW-2. This well is <br /> located along the perimeter of the fenced area with a field upgradient. <br /> Nitrate concentrations in soil samples analyzed from the borings ranged from <br /> 3.0 mg/Kg to 58 mg/Kg as nitrogen <br /> l <br />
